Replication timing and epigenome remodelling are associated with the nature of chromosomal rearrangements in cancer
DNA replication timing is known to facilitate the establishment of the epigenome, however, the intimate connection between replication timing and changes to the genome and epigenome in cancer remain largely uncharacterised.
